Surrey Police is the territorial police force responsible for law enforcement and crime prevention in the county of Surrey, England. Their mission is to keep Surrey safe by tackling crime, protecting vulnerable individuals, and working in partnership with communities. They strive to provide a visible, accessible, and responsive policing service, focusing on local priorities and delivering justice for victims.

Surrey Police's internal and professional email communication typically follows a standard format, usually combining an individual's first and last name with the official domain. However, for public inquiries or reporting incidents, Surrey Police strongly encourages the use of official channels such as calling 101 (non-emergency), 999 (emergency), or utilizing the online reporting tools and contact forms available on their website. Direct email to individual officers is generally not the primary method for public contact to ensure inquiries are logged, tracked, and directed appropriately.
